Antonio Giovinazzi still in dark over Alfa Romeo F1 future amid rumours

Antonio Giovinazzi says he is focusing his energy on his performances with uncertainty lingering over his Formula 1 future at Alfa Romeo.

Alfa Romeo announced it had signed Valtteri 𓄧Bottas on Monday to replace the retiring Kimi Raikkonen, leaving the identity of who will partner the Finn next season as the biggest remaining question mark heading into 2022. 

Giovinazzi is out of contract at the end of the year and Alfa Romeo is no longer contractually oblig𝔍ed to field a Ferrari Academy Driver member in its line-up.

There is growin🐷g talk that Alpine junior and Formula 2 frontrunner Guanyu Zhou is firmly in the frame for the seat, while other drivers including Nyck de Vries have been linked, though the newly-crowned Formula E world champion’s ties to Mercedes could prove problematic.

Speaking ahead of his home race, the Italian Grand Prix, Giovinazzi stressed he has not been giv♒en any indications about his future yet.

“Nothing yet - I have no news yet, I just knew that Valtter﷽i will be in Alfa next year but from my side, no news yet,” said the Italian.

Asked whether there is a deadline for the decision, Giovinazzi replied: “Not really to be honest. Of course I wan𒐪t to kn𒆙ow as soon as possible but it’s not my decision.

“I🍰’ve said this many times already, I know there is a lot of rumours but it is not my ♐decision.

“So my focus is mo💟re on my performance, to do my best result in the race, in the qualifyi𓂃ng and everything and then see what will happen.”

Giovinazzi has faced uncertainty over his future in e𒅌ach of his three ca🐈mpaigns in F1 due to the nature of his year-by-year deals.

“F🍃or sure it’s always been the same September from my side over these last thr🔯ee years,” he explained. “There was always some rumours for the next year.

“For me, I don’ಞt want to focus much on these because it’s just losing energy. I want to focus more on performance on myself and try to do my best.

“Like I say many times, it is not my decision a✱nd whatever happens will happen. My target is to be happy with myself and see what will ha📖ppen.”

A puncture ruined Giovinazzi’s chance of a points finish at Zandvoort following his💟 best-ever qualifying result to take seventh on the grid.

Despite only scoring one point so far in 2021 with P10 in Monaco, Giovinazzi is happy with hisౠ efforts this year.

“I’m not the person that I will give a vote to myself but to be honest I’m really happy with my quali compa🍸red to Kimi,” he said.

“In the race we were a little bi𝓡t unlucky many times to be honest with pit stops and everything. But yeah, for myself I’m doing my best and therefore I’m pretty happy with my development.

“From last year and compared to two years ago as well, so I’m really happy with myself𓆏 and I will continue to gi🍎ve 110 percent to do give the best result to the team and then we will see what will happen.”
